You-Chen Ye, Bass drum, Gong, Cymbal, Triangle and Tambourine concertmaster
- Interviewer|Yi-Xuan Lin
- Interviewee|You-Chen Ye, Bass drum, Gong, Cymbal, Triangle and Tambourine concertmaster
|
|
- Why did you join the Children Orchestra?
A: My form teacher recommended it and my parents agreed with it.
- How long have you learned for these instruments? (Bass Drum, Gong, Cymbal, Triangle, and Tambourine)
A: One semester.
- What's the structure of the bass drum?
A:It is common in 36 inches. The surface of both sides was made of leather but it usually made of plastic now. The body was made of woods but nowadays synthetic fiber for timpani or snare drum.
- Does it sound good?
A: Yes.
- What's the weight of the cymbal?
A: About 2 kgs.
- Which song is the most difficult one in the songs you every practice?
A: Radetzky March.
- Is it tiring to control 5 instruments at once?
A: Yes, but I feel excited.
- Did you like them?
A: Yes, and I learned a lot in these instruments.
